Product details

  • Actors: James Belushi, Kim Cattrall, Angie Dickinson, Robert Loggia, Ben Savage
  • Directors: Kathryn Bigelow, Keith Gordon, Phil Joanou, Peter Hewitt
  • Format: PAL
  • Region: Region 2 (This DVD may not be viewable outside Europe. Read more about DVD formats.)
  • Number of discs: 2
  • Classification: 15
  • Studio: Fremantle Home Entertainment
  • DVD Release Date: 31 Mar 2008
  • Run Time: 275 minutes
  • Average Customer Review: 5.0 out of 5 stars  See all reviews (2 customer reviews)
  • ASIN: B00139B74A
  • Amazon.co.uk Sales Rank: 27,873 in DVD (See Bestsellers in DVD)

Reviews

Synopsis

The life of a TV executive living in the year 2007 becomes unraveled when new technology for television transmission makes things appear differently than what they really are.

5.0 out of 5 stars See the Rhino, 16 Jun 2008
By C. S. Ebrey - See all my reviews
(REAL NAME)   
A stylish and enigmatic TV drama that draws you in as the intrigue unfolds. From the first episode the acting is brilliant as James Belushi stars in a well typcast role and is totally unpredictable at every turn. The story twists and turns in such a way as to lead you down paths, only to emerge in a totally unexpected place. The futuristic appearance of the cast combined with an excellent plot make this a joy to watch. It is lavishly produced and won't fail to disappoint those who enjoy something a little quirky and off the wall. It is remeniscent of a Quentin Tarantino film. The storyline revolves around a TV giant of the future and it's director who has a vision of what future TV should look like. Not wanting to spoil the plot, watch it and enjoy the experience of mimicom.

5.0 out of 5 stars Confused, You Should Be!, 31 May 2009
By S. Jones "Jonah" (Bilston, England) - See all my reviews
(REAL NAME)   
How to describe this series? In the words of Colonel Melchett in Blackadder, it has more twists and turns than a twisty, turny thing! Even when Angie Dickinson was asked what it was all about, she replied "I don't know"! But all said, this series does one thing other series rarely do these days, it makes you think. It's a very clever series that when answering one question, asks another two. I think that can be put down to having Oliver Stone at the helm. Like his films, he dares to ask questions that nobody else does. A mixture of drama and science fiction (special effects are superb) and a stellar cast including Jim Belushi, Dana Delaney, Angie Dickinson (A brilliant Cruella De Ville role), Robert Loggia, Kim Cattrall, David Warner, Ernie Hudson plus a superb cameoe from Brad Douriff make this a must see DVD for all conspiracy theorists.
